Abbey and cathedral churches generally Keep to the Latin Cross strategy. In England, the extension eastward may be prolonged, even though in Italy it is often small or non-existent, the church getting of T approach, often with apses on the transept ends together with towards the east.
In France, Burgundy was the centre of monasticism. The enormous and impressive monastery at Cluny was to acquire lasting effect on the structure of other monasteries and the look of their churches. Hardly any of the abbey church at Cluny continues to be; the "Cluny II" rebuilding of 963 onwards has absolutely vanished, but We've a good suggestion of the design of "Cluny III" from 1088 to 1130, which until the Renaissance remained the most important setting up in Europe.
